Initially I pricked the bike. Then I added the watercolour and lastly did the stitching.
Often when using watercolour on card stock the card gets a little warped. I learnt this trick to counter that from Debbie Hughes at Limedoodle. Double sided foam tape in long stripes makes it lie a bit flatter. I usually only use squares of it on all my other cards.
